Output 56a1fcbee91a253b79b9b5b03b433b1e0efffd3dc44daaf7320d0200e78ab87d:1

value
77968
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4d3144365c8bb37cc00f73000c117d92832ffbcb OP_EQUAL
address
38jAyQceXLToPrGLLH5bxqYe1fZMkecot7
transaction
56a1fcbee91a253b79b9b5b03b433b1e0efffd3dc44daaf7320d0200e78ab87d
spent
true